The second is at the uber cool bar / restaurant Haakon. Located in central Oslo, at the headquarters of property experts Braathen Eiendom in a beautiful 1950s building, the architects created discernible zones, timeless in nature, and flexible in function, reflecting their multiple roles as bar, restaurant and private function. Materials are designed to work in harmony with the existing structure, and consist of sanded concrete, black steel, and walnut and brass details.
